Our students are bright children whose dyslexia or other learning differences present challenges that have previously prevented them from finding success in other schools.
Summit student profiles might include dyslexia, dyscalculia, dysgraphia, processing difficulties, memory challenges, weak language abilities, as well as attention and executive function concerns. Our program is designed to prepare students for success in high school, college, and beyond.
Our program is not designed to serve students with a primary diagnosis of Attention Deficit-Hyperactivity Disorder, a behavior disorder, a severe communication disorder, Asperger’s, Autism; or for children who fall below the average range on measures of cognitive ability.
The Summit School’s expertise lies in closing the gap in literacy, math, written language and organization. If your child is not progressing in their current school or has a learning difference such as dyslexia, we invite you to learn more about Summit and how we teach differently.
Is The Summit School right for my child?
Summit makes sense for students who:
- demonstrate weaknesses in language processing, working memory, comprehension or organization
- are bright and want to learn, but are falling behind
- are encountering difficulty with reading, writing, spelling, math, organization or self-management
- thrive when teachers listen and adapt to individual needs
- are most successful when learning is active and expectations reflect their learning profile.
